编程研发的产品是什么
-
编程研发的产品是指通过编写、测试和维护计算机程序来实现特定功能或解决特定问题的软件产品。编程研发的产品种类繁多,包括但不限于以下几种:
-
应用软件:应用软件是为满足用户需求而开发的具体程序,如办公软件(如文字处理软件、电子表格软件、演示文稿软件)、图像编辑软件、音视频播放软件、网页浏览器等。
-
游戏软件:游戏软件是以娱乐为目的,通过编程实现游戏逻辑和图形处理的软件产品。游戏软件涵盖了众多类型,包括电子游戏、手游、网游等。
-
操作系统:操作系统是管理计算机硬件和软件资源的核心软件,用于管理和控制计算机的各种功能和任务,如Windows、Mac OS、Linux等。
-
数据库管理系统:数据库管理系统用于存储、管理和组织大量数据,如关系型数据库(如MySQL、Oracle、SQL Server)和非关系型数据库(如MongoDB、Redis)等。
-
嵌入式软件:嵌入式软件是嵌入到特定硬件设备中的软件,用于控制和管理设备的运行。嵌入式软件广泛应用于各种电子设备,如手机、电视、智能家电、汽车等。
-
网络安全软件:网络安全软件用于保护计算机和网络系统免受恶意攻击和数据泄露等威胁,如防火墙、杀毒软件、入侵检测系统等。
-
算法与人工智能软件:算法与人工智能软件用于进行数据分析、机器学习、人工智能等任务,广泛应用于金融、医疗、交通等领域。
总之,编程研发的产品包括各种软件和系统,涵盖了从日常应用到底层核心功能的广泛领域。不同类型的编程研发产品有不同的应用场景和功能,但都是基于计算机编程和软件开发的结果。
1年前 -
-
编程研发的产品是指通过编程和软件开发技术所创建的各种软件和应用程序。这些产品可以包括但不限于以下几个方面:
-
桌面应用程序:这类产品是安装在计算机桌面上运行的软件,可以提供各种功能,比如办公软件(如Microsoft Office),图形设计软件(如Adobe Photoshop)等。
-
移动应用程序:随着智能手机和平板电脑的普及,移动应用程序成为了非常重要的领域。这类产品可以在移动设备上下载和安装,提供各种服务和功能,比如社交媒体应用(如Facebook),游戏应用(如Candy Crush Saga)等。
-
网络应用程序:这类产品是通过互联网进行访问和使用的应用程序。它们运行在远程服务器上,通过浏览器来访问。常见的网络应用程序包括电子邮件服务(如Gmail),在线购物平台(如Amazon),在线社交媒体平台(如Twitter)等。
-
嵌入式系统:嵌入式系统是指被嵌入在各种设备中的计算机系统,用于控制和管理设备的相关功能。这类产品可以包括智能家居系统,汽车电子系统,医疗设备等。
-
游戏开发:编程研发的产品还包括游戏开发。游戏开发涉及到图形设计、物理引擎、人工智能等技术,用于创造各种类型的游戏,包括电脑游戏、移动游戏、掌上游戏等。
总的来说,编程研发的产品涵盖了各个领域和行业,对现代社会的各个方面都有着重要的影响。通过编程研发的产品,我们可以实现各种功能,提高工作效率,丰富娱乐生活,促进科学研究等。
1年前 -
-
编程研发的产品是指通过计算机程序开发和实现的软件或应用。它可以包括各种类型的软件,如手机应用、网页应用、桌面软件、嵌入式系统等。编程研发的产品可以用于不同的领域和行业,满足用户的需求和解决问题。
以下是编程研发产品的一般流程和主要步骤:
-
需求分析:首先需要理解客户对产品的需求和项目背景,明确目标和范围。通过与客户交流和沟通,确定产品的功能、特性和用户界面设计等方面的要求。
-
系统设计:在需求分析的基础上,进行系统的设计。包括制定软件架构、定义数据库结构、规划用户界面等。系统设计需要考虑产品的可扩展性和可维护性,确保系统的稳定性和性能。
-
编码实现:根据系统设计的方案,进行编码实现。开发人员使用合适的编程语言和工具进行编码,实现产品的各个功能和模块。
-
单元测试:开发人员对编码实现的各个单元进行测试,确保代码的正确性和可靠性。单元测试通常是通过编写测试用例,并对每个单元进行测试和验证。
-
集成测试:将各个模块和组件进行集成测试,验证系统的功能和性能。集成测试主要是将已完成和测试通过的单元进行整合,测试不同模块之间的协作和交互。
-
系统测试:对整个系统进行测试,验证产品的功能和性能是否符合需求。系统测试是在模拟真实环境下进行的,以确保产品在各种使用情景下的稳定性和可用性。
-
产品发布:完成测试后,将产品准备好并发布给用户。发布包括安装和配置,确保用户能够顺利地使用和操作产品。
-
维护和更新:产品发布后,需要进行后续的维护和更新工作。包括对产品的bug修复、功能升级和性能优化等。维护和更新是产品持续改进和提高的过程。
总结:编程研发的产品是通过计算机程序开发和实现的软件或应用。主要流程包括需求分析、系统设计、编码实现、单元测试、集成测试、系统测试、产品发布以及维护和更新。这些步骤确保产品能够满足用户需求,具有稳定性和可用性。
1年前 -